New Jersey 2024-2025 Regular Session

New Jersey Assembly Bill A5268

Caption

Authorizes expanded use of electronic procurement for public bidding conducted by county college.

Impact

The impact of A5268 on state laws includes an amendment to existing statutes that govern county college contracts, specifically the 'County College Contracts Law.' The legislation allows county colleges to implement more modern procurement practices while still maintaining obligations for transparency. It necessitates that county colleges continue to adhere to specific legal requirements, such as advertisements in legal newspapers, thereby balancing innovation with accountability. This change is anticipated to streamline the bidding process and provide cost savings through more competitive bidding environments.

Summary

Assembly Bill A5268 aims to improve the efficiency and transparency of public contracts awarded by county colleges in New Jersey. The bill expands the use of electronic procurement in public bidding, enabling county colleges to publish bids and receive proposals electronically. This is a significant shift from traditional methods that relied heavily on physical publications in legal newspapers, thereby modernizing the procurement process to reach a wider pool of potential bidders, enhancing competition and potentially resulting in better value for taxpayers.

Contention

While the bill has garnered support for its potential improvements to efficiency and transparency, some stakeholders express concerns regarding the reliability and fairness of electronic procurement systems. Issues related to ensuring equal access for all bidders, including those who may be less familiar with technology, have been raised. Additionally, there is a concern about how electronic systems will handle vulnerabilities related to data security and privacy during the procurement process. Ensuring a robust framework to safeguard the process will be crucial for its successful implementation.
